Ukraine: Another Russian general killed, according to Kyiv

Kyiv today confirmed that it had killed another Russian general in a battle in southern Ukraine, according to Ukrainian presidential adviser Oleksy Arestovich.

“Our troops (…) killed the commander of the 49th Army of the southern region of Russia, General Iakov Rezanchev, in a bombing of the Chornombaevka airport, located in the Kherson region (south),” Arestovich told a

Russia has so far confirmed the death in Ukraine of General Andrei Sukovetsky, deputy commander of the 41st Army, who had served in Syria in 2018-2019.

But another Russian general, Vitaly Gerasimov, has also been killed in the fighting, according to Kyiv.

“Another two-star general was killed today by the Russian side, he is the second in 12 days,” retired US General Mark Hertling told CNN on March 8, revealing that the Russian military was making “repeated mistakes” and “communicating through non-encrypted media “.
